Lawyers for the 'Irishman' star argued that Hightower's credit card limit had been slashed because their client had taken a sizeable financial hit due to the coronavirus lockdown. Restaurant chain Nobu and the Greenwich Hotel, both of which De Niro has stakes in, have been mostly defunct for months without any business.
Nobu "lost $3 million in April and another $1.87 million in May." She added that De Niro had to pay investors "$500,000 on a capital call" after he borrowed the money from his business partners "because he doesn’t have the cash,"
De Niro is required to pay Hightower $1 million a year only if he's making $15 million or more in income...
“His accounts and business manager … says that the best case for Mr. De Niro, if everything starts to turn around this year,… he is going to be lucky if he makes $7.5 million this year,” Krauss said.

But Keven McDonough, a lawyer representing Hightower, believes “the idea that Mr. De Niro is tightening his belt is nonsense.”
“Mr. De Niro has used the COVID pandemic, my words would be, to stick it to his wife financially,” McDonough said. “I’m not a believer that a man who has an admitted worth of $500 million and makes $30 million a year, all of a sudden in March he needs to cut down [spousal support] by 50 percent and ban her from the house,” he added.
